TeraWulf (NASDAQ:WULF) Price Target Raised to $30.00

TeraWulf (NASDAQ:WULFGet Free Report) had its target price boosted by Cantor Fitzgerald from $24.00 to $30.00 in a research note issued on Thursday,Benzinga reports. The brokerage presently has an “overweight” rating on the stock. Cantor Fitzgerald’s target price suggests a potential upside of 58.69% from the company’s previous close.

WULF has been the topic of several other research reports. Keefe, Bruyette & Woods cut their price target on TeraWulf from $24.00 to $23.00 and set an “outperform” rating on the stock in a research note on Wednesday, March 11th. Needham & Company LLC restated a “buy” rating and issued a $21.00 price target on shares of TeraWulf in a research note on Tuesday, February 3rd. Rosenblatt Securities restated a “buy” rating and issued a $23.00 price target on shares of TeraWulf in a research note on Thursday, March 19th. Weiss Ratings reissued a “sell (d-)” rating on shares of TeraWulf in a research report on Friday, March 27th. Finally, Arete Research initiated coverage on shares of TeraWulf in a research report on Monday, March 23rd. They set a “buy” rating and a $30.00 price objective on the stock. Twelve research anal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, one has given a Hold rating and one has given a Sell rating to the company’s stock. According to data from MarketBeat.com, TeraWulf presently has a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” and a consensus target price of $23.08.

TeraWulf Stock Up 4.7%

Shares of NASDAQ:WULF traded up $0.86 during midday trading on Thursday, reaching $18.91. The company’s stock had a trading volume of 17,025,875 shares, compared to its average volume of 30,746,523. TeraWulf has a 12-month low of $2.18 and a 12-month high of $19.21. The firm has a market capitalization of $8.02 billion, a P/E ratio of -11.53 and a beta of 3.69. The firm has a 50 day moving average of $15.40 and a 200-day moving average of $14.02. The company has a quick ratio of 2.00, a current ratio of 2.00 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 33.00.

About TeraWulf

TeraWulf, Inc (NASDAQ: WULF) is a digital asset infrastructure company focused on the development and operation of zero-carbon bitcoin mining facilities. The company integrates sustainable power generation with high-density data center technologies to deliver environmentally responsible digital asset mining services. Its core business revolves around designing, building and operating large-scale mining projects powered exclusively by renewable or emissions-free energy sources.

One of TeraWulf’s flagship projects is “Project Nautilus,” located in Tompkins County, New York, which harnesses hydroelectric power sourced from the New York State Electric & Gas (NYSEG) grid.
